dxvahd.h) (DXVAHD_BLT_STATE_TARGET_RECT_DATA 结构

指定使用 Microsoft DirectX 视频加速高清 (DXVA-HD) 时用于分条的目标矩形。

语法

typedef struct _DXVAHD_BLT_STATE_TARGET_RECT_DATA {
  BOOL Enable;
  RECT TargetRect;
} DXVAHD_BLT_STATE_TARGET_RECT_DATA;

成员

Enable

指定是否使用目标矩形。 默认状态值为 FALSE

含义
TRUE
使用 由 TargetRect 成员指定的目标矩形。
FALSE
使用整个目标图面作为目标矩形。 忽略 TargetRect 成员。

TargetRect

指定 目标矩形。 目标矩形是目标图面中将绘制输出的区域。 目标矩形以相对于目标图面的像素坐标提供。 默认状态值为空矩形, (0、0、0、0) 。

如果 Enable 成员为 FALSE,则忽略 TargetRect 成员。

要求

要求
最低受支持的客户端 Windows 7 [仅限桌面应用]
最低受支持的服务器 Windows Server 2008 R2 [仅限桌面应用]
标头 dxvahd.h

另请参阅

DXVA-HD

DXVAHD_BLT_STATE

Direct3D 视频结构

IDXVAHD_VideoProcessor::SetVideoProcessBltState

媒体基础结构